Small Bathroom Organization Ideas for Renters: 5 Easy Storage Tips

A clean bathroom featuring a sink, toilet, and a shower, all in a modern design.If you rent, organizing a small bathroom can appear overwhelming. Landlord regulations, insufficient storage capacity, and communal spaces can make it hard to keep things tidy and effective. Fortunately, you don’t need to renovate or make permanent changes to get an orderly and stress-free environment. Utilize these renter-friendly tips to optimize your storage capacity, declutter your bathroom, and maintain tranquility, all while protecting your security deposit. These practical suggestions are applicable to any rental bathroom, regardless of its size.

Step 1: Declutter Your Bathroom Storage

Prioritize decluttering your rental bathroom prior to organizing it. It’s simple to collect extra toiletries, outdated goods, and unused items that clutter counters and cabinets. Examining your medicine cabinet, sink, and toilet drawers will assist you in determining what you genuinely utilize. Dispose of expired medications, cosmetics, and any other items that have surpassed their expiration date. Group similar items like cleaning materials, hair accessories, and skin care items, and discard the extras you haven’t used in a year. This presents a fresh start for storage solutions that fit in rentals.

Step 2: Categorize Bathroom Items by Usage

Organize your belongings into categories after you’ve decluttered. Establish arrangements according to your daily routine if you independently utilize the restroom each day. Establish a shelf, bucket, or box for items required in the morning and another for those needed in the evening. Individuals sharing a bathroom should possess separate caddies for their personal items that can be stored on a shelf or in a cabinet.

Step 3: Use Clear Storage Containers for Small Bathrooms

Clear storage containers are ideal for rental bathrooms as they provide immediate visibility of contents. This enables you to avoid buying duplicates and makes small rooms feel less packed.

  • Shallow drawer organizers for hair accessories, cosmetics, and toothbrushes
  • Stackable clear bins for the storage of surplus towels, toiletries, and cleaning implements beneath the sink
  • Transparent, tall containers to optimize vertical cabinet space
  • Portable solutions that move with you to your next rental

Step 4: Assign a Designated Spot for Everything

Ensure that every item has a designated location when you reorganize your bathroom. Fewer possessions yield greater benefits. Attempt to keep things off the counter by using bins, drawers, and baskets. Putting labels on your storage containers is an effective method for locating desired items.

Step 5: Maximize Vertical Space in Your Rental Bathroom

Inadequately sized bathrooms can appear congested, leading to a lack of space. However, there’s often unused space that can be exploited to maintain organization:

  • Command hooks for shower caps, robes, and hair tools on the back of doors
  • Over-the-door organizers for efficient, damage-free storage
  • Standalone storage cabinets positioned above the toilet or suspended shelves
  • Hooks adjacent to the sinks for suspending spray bottles
  • Adhesive racks inside cabinet doors for cleaning and styling tools

These damage-free solutions can optimize your space while staying within your lease agreement.
